What do I need to buy for raspberry pi 3 b+?

At a minimum - a high-quality power supply and a memory card.
USB cord if the household does not have one.
If you need to toss the HDMI cable to the monitor
The case and the set of radiators - to taste
The rest - depends on your tasks.
What tasks will the board solve?
In general, take a microUSB cable from your phone. Buying separately, you can fly into thick insulation with hair instead of conductors.
A memory card is not from the category "a handful for 100 rubles on ali".
If you need a network, then the network cable is the right length.
If it will output something to the monitor, then the HDMI cable is the right length.
If it reads some sensors, then the sensors themselves will be needed, power to them, because the GPIO on the raspberry seems to give out a maximum of 6mA. And possibly 5-3.3V level converters.
I recommend buying a set of radiators. They cost 100 rubles, and the temperature will be lowered significantly.
The case is also desirable, at least for aesthetic reasons.
If you are going to make a router out of raspberries, then think again, because the network and everything else there hangs on one USB controller, i.e. bandwidth will be shared by all.
NAS from it is also so-so for the same reason.
